Geographical Environment Observation Services

Objective

The GEOS project aims as addressing the increasing requirements of legal information about the environment, follwing the reception, in the European Single Act, of the "environment" as a fundamental element in the life of European Community, and following the development of specific rules for the environment (about 200 directives).

The GEOS project undertakes a wider environmental concept, in conformity with the Community view (art. 3 of directive on environmental impact evaluation and European Single Act principles), in such a way as to orient the information especially towards prevention of environmental damage and towards the best environmental exploitation.

The GEOS project considers as fundamental the geographical dimension of legal information in such a way that legal regulations will be related directly to the territory and the Community rules will be contemplated in their real application on a European territorial basis.

The GEOS project will make available to a large number of users a legal-environmental database; in fact the access keys to data will be simple and easy to use: the end users do not need to be expert in GIS, nor in legal information retrieval.

The information will be selected with particular attention to the economic world and the public administrations; this will ensure marketability to the services and, consequently, the indispensable updating of the database.
